US Bancorp DE trimmed its position in Rockwell Automation, Inc. (NYSE:ROK - Free Report) by 1.7% during the 2nd qu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The firm owned 75,624 shares of the industrial products company's stock after selling 1,318 shares during the period. US Bancorp DE owned 0.07% of Rockwell Automation worth $25,120,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Insider Buying and Selling

In other Rockwell Automation news, CEO Blake D. Moret sold 24,400 shares of the stock in a transaction dated Thursday, September 11th. The stock was sold at an average price of $350.13, for a total value of $8,543,172.00. Following the transaction, the chief executive officer owned 83,873 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$29,366,453.49. This represents a 22.54%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The transaction was disclosed in a legal fil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which can be accessed through the SEC website. Also, SVP Cyril Perducat sold 1,435 shares of the stock in a transaction dated Friday, August 29th. The shares were sold at an average price of $348.08, for a total value of $499,494.80. Following the completion of the transaction, the senior vice president directly owned 3,787 shares in the company, valued at approximately $1,318,178.96. This represents a 27.48% decrease in their position. The disclosure for this sale can be found here. Insiders have sold 31,922 shares of company stock valued at $11,191,812 in the last 90 days. Insiders own 0.68% of the company's stock.

Rockwell Automation (NYSE:ROK -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, August 6th. The industrial products company reported $2.82 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$2.67 by $0.15. The firm had revenue of $2.14 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$2.07 billion. Rockwell Automation had a return on equity of 30.14% and a net margin of 12.03%.The company's quarterly revenue was up 4.5%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period in the prior year, the company posted $2.71 earnings per share. Sell-side analysts expect that Rockwell Automation, Inc. will post 9.35 earnings per share for the current year.

About Rockwell Automation

(Free Report)

Rockwell Automation, Inc provides industrial automation and digital transformation solutions in North America,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, the Asia Pacific, and Latin America. The company operates through three segments, Intelligent Devices, Software & Control, and Lifecycle Services. Its solutions include hardware and software products and services.
